Jeep Wrangler Seating Basics
The Jeep Wrangler is famous for its tough design and off-road abilities. But when it comes to seating, the answer is not always simple. There are two main versions: 2-door and 4-door (called the Wrangler Unlimited). Each has a different number of seats and interior layout.
- The 2-door Wrangler usually seats 4 people.
- The 4-door Wrangler Unlimited seats 5 people.
These numbers are standard for new Jeep Wranglers, but there are some variations depending on the year, trim, and special editions. Let’s look at these options more closely.
Seating By Model: 2-door Vs 4-door Wrangler
The number of seats in your Jeep Wrangler depends on which version you choose. Here’s a clear breakdown:
| Model | Doors | Standard Seats | Rear Seats Fold? |
|---|---|---|---|
| Wrangler (Base, Sport, Rubicon, etc.) | 2-door | 4 | Yes (split-folding) |
| Wrangler Unlimited (Sahara, Rubicon, Willys, etc.) | 4-door | 5 | Yes (split-folding) |
- 2-door Wranglers have two front seats and a smaller back seat for two passengers.
- 4-door Wranglers have two front seats and a rear bench that fits three passengers.
Key Insight: Many beginners think all Wranglers seat five, but the 2-door model only seats four. This matters if you often drive with more than three passengers.

Interior Layout And Comfort
How comfortable are the seats in a Jeep Wrangler? The answer depends on which model you pick and how you plan to use your Jeep.
Front Seat Space
Both the 2-door and 4-door models give the driver and front passenger good legroom and headroom. The seats are upright and offer a clear view of the road, which is great for off-roading. You can get cloth or leather seats, depending on the trim.
Back Seat Space
Here’s where things differ:
- 2-door Wrangler: The back seat is smaller. It’s best for kids, teens, or short trips. Adults can fit, but taller people may feel cramped, especially on long drives.
- 4-door Wrangler Unlimited: The back seat is much roomier. Three adults can sit comfortably, and there’s more legroom and easier access thanks to the extra doors.
Useful Data: Interior Measurements
To help you see the difference, here’s a comparison of interior space in 2024 Jeep Wrangler models:
| Model | Front Legroom (in) | Rear Legroom (in) | Rear Shoulder Room (in) |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2-door | 41.2 | 35.7 | 57.7 |
| 4-door | 41.2 | 38.3 | 55.7 |
As you can see, the 4-door version offers more space for back seat passengers.
Can You Fit Car Seats In A Jeep Wrangler?
Parents often ask if you can safely fit child seats in a Jeep Wrangler. The answer is yes, but there are some details to understand.
- 2-door Wrangler: You can install child seats in the back, but it’s harder to get them in and out. The back seat is small, so rear-facing seats may not fit well unless the front seat is moved forward.
- 4-door Wrangler Unlimited: Easier access and more space. Both rear-facing and forward-facing car seats fit better. LATCH anchors are available in newer models for better safety.
Tip: If you plan to use car seats often, the 4-door Wrangler is a much better choice for daily comfort and safety.

How The Jeep Wrangler Seats Compare To Other Suvs
If you’re looking at other vehicles, it’s helpful to see how the Jeep Wrangler’s seating capacity stacks up.
- Toyota 4Runner: Seats 5, with an optional third row (seats 7 in some trims).
- Ford Bronco: Similar to Wrangler—2-door seats 4, 4-door seats 5.
- Subaru Outback: Seats 5.
Most compact and midsize SUVs seat five people, but only a few can go beyond that without moving up to a larger class.

Seat Folding, Cargo Flexibility, And Everyday Use
Both Jeep Wrangler models have rear seats that fold down. This is useful when you need more cargo space for groceries, luggage, or outdoor gear.
- 2-door: The back seats fold but don’t create a flat floor.
- 4-door: The rear bench folds in a 60/40 split, letting you carry both passengers and cargo.
This flexibility is one of the Wrangler’s strengths for people with active lifestyles.
